JAMB urges candidates to print exam notification slip for 2026 UTME

By our Reporter

The Joint Admissions and Matriculation Board (JAMB) has announced that all candidates registered for the 2026 Unified Tertiary Matriculation Examination (UTME) can now print their Examination Notification Slips.

This was disclosed in a statement issued on Thursday in Abuja by JAMB’s Public Communication Advisor, Fabian Benjamin.

According to him, the 2026 UTME is scheduled to commence on Thursday, 16 April 2026, across approved Computer-Based Test (CBT) centres nationwide.

Benjamin emphasised the importance of the exam notification slip, noting that it contains vital information such as each candidate’s examination date, venue, and time. He urged all candidates to print the slip early to avoid last-minute challenges

To access the slip, candidates are to visit the Board’s official website, www.jamb.gov.ng, and click on the “2026 UTME Slip Printing” link.

“Each candidate has been assigned a specific schedule, and it is important they arrive at their designated centre well ahead of time to allow for proper screening and accreditation before the commencement of the examination,” the statement added.

JAMB also revealed that the 2026 UTME will feature enhanced security measures aimed at combating examination malpractice. Candidates and CBT centre owners were cautioned to adhere strictly to examination guidelines, as the Board will apply stringent sanctions against any form of misconduct.

The Board further encouraged candidates to familiarise themselves with their examination centres ahead of the scheduled date to ensure a smooth and hitch-free exercise.
